T&L Co., Ltd. (KOSDAQ:340570)
South Korea flag South Korea · Delayed Price · Currency is KRW
73,100
+200 (0.27%)
Last updated: May 14, 2025

T&L Co., Ltd. Ratios and Metrics

Millions KRW.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2018 - 2019
Period Ending
May '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2018 - 2019
Market Capitalization
588,450540,018322,880292,207384,454173,939
Upgrade
Market Cap Growth
67.25%67.25%10.50%-23.99%121.03%-
Upgrade
Enterprise Value
513,751474,185282,392255,615350,799172,673
Upgrade
Last Close Price
72900.0066900.0039524.5635286.3645541.6420418.00
Upgrade
PE Ratio
12.6811.6411.7713.8419.6317.32
Upgrade
Forward PE
10.0110.048.899.7114.41-
Upgrade
PS Ratio
3.363.092.803.585.354.28
Upgrade
PB Ratio
3.433.152.492.764.272.42
Upgrade
P/TBV Ratio
3.513.222.552.804.352.46
Upgrade
P/FCF Ratio
19.1417.5716.87-114.0027.32
Upgrade
P/OCF Ratio
12.6411.609.9118.9720.2318.61
Upgrade
EV/Sales Ratio
2.942.712.453.134.884.25
Upgrade
EV/EBITDA Ratio
8.447.798.409.6814.6115.94
Upgrade
EV/EBIT Ratio
9.028.329.1610.5215.7118.00
Upgrade
EV/FCF Ratio
16.7115.4314.76-104.0227.12
Upgrade
Debt / Equity Ratio
0.000.000.000.000.000.00
Upgrade
Debt / EBITDA Ratio
0.010.010.000.000.010.01
Upgrade
Debt / FCF Ratio
0.020.020.01-0.070.01
Upgrade
Asset Turnover
1.031.030.890.760.810.66
Upgrade
Inventory Turnover
6.116.116.005.396.805.63
Upgrade
Quick Ratio
3.963.965.194.716.436.68
Upgrade
Current Ratio
4.834.836.406.047.497.57
Upgrade
Return on Equity (ROE)
30.84%30.84%23.29%21.53%24.17%19.09%
Upgrade
Return on Assets (ROA)
20.99%20.99%14.88%14.11%15.70%9.77%
Upgrade
Return on Capital (ROIC)
23.61%23.61%16.34%15.46%17.19%11.04%
Upgrade
Return on Capital Employed (ROCE)
32.80%32.80%23.60%22.70%24.50%13.10%
Upgrade
Earnings Yield
7.89%8.59%8.50%7.23%5.09%5.77%
Upgrade
FCF Yield
5.22%5.69%5.93%-0.20%0.88%3.66%
Upgrade
Dividend Yield
1.06%1.12%----
Upgrade
Payout Ratio
9.57%9.57%13.24%15.40%8.30%12.75%
Upgrade
Buyback Yield / Dilution
--0.54%0.15%-22.11%-4.00%
Upgrade
Total Shareholder Return
1.06%1.12%0.54%0.15%-22.11%-4.00%
Upgrade
Updated Mar 17,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.